Yup, an active dashpot with exponential decay. Am reading upmuythaibxr wrote:OK, separating the CL targets from CL idle and making them independent should not be a problem. I will do it in MS3 and backport. Right now the lookup is only active if CL idle is active.
As far as the dashpot goes, I feel it doesn't work like a real dashpot, so perhaps making it do so is the right way to go? I really don't want yet another table or curve associated with the idle feature, I want to remove some of the tunables while retaining or improving the functionality.
As such, my proposal is that the dashpot work like a real one and open the valve extra like it does now on throttle lift and then close back to the last good or table value over a specified time period. This is how the 2 or 3 OEMs I have seen work (mainly for emissions but with other benefits too). The initial position table can then be used to set the initial RPM going into PID with the dashpot doig what a dashpot should.

A solution is to tie the decay rate to inverse rpmDOT so that large rpmDOT values slow the decay and small rpmDOT values increase the decay.Greg G wrote: I don't know if it should taper over a specified period of time because we can enter the throttle lift period from so many different scenarios. My thinking is, if we want to control the RPMdot, then we should tie dashpot to it somehow.
A simple way to do this could be;
Dashpot duty = UV x ( abs(rpmDOT) / 1000)
Where UV = user value duty adder
As rpmDOT fluxuates so would dashpot, factored around a user value to magnify or reduce the effect etc. When entering PID the dashpot would be canceled (zero) but actively updated all the time during throttle lifted. To tie into valve closed it could only be active when rpm is below the closed value (right now it just abruptly opens regardless of the rpm that throttle lift occurred).
Simple to tune and probably equally effective.

I figured it out. The AC adder disables dashpot somehow (during throttle lift). So when I am driving with no AC and lift the throttle, I get initial value table (IVT) duty plus dashpot. With the AC on, I get IVT duty plus AC adder, instead of IVT duty plus dashpot plus AC adder. So I have a consistent droop on throttle lift when AC is on.
While typing this, I realized I could solve it if I just set dashpot to zero, and incorporate the dashpot value into the IVT...
But i suppose it's a simple fix to get both adders added?
The good news--idle valve duty voltage correction has the nice side effect of acting as a sort of antistall, since if the RPMs go down really low, the voltage drops and the voltage correction opens up the valve.
